lock-svg project
Successfully occupied
View project information dropdown icon
Wallet icon Coin icon Rate 4 800 € - 6 000 € / month info
Timer icon Form of cooperation Full-time / 60% Remote
Briefcase icon Sector Banking
Location icon Location Bratislava

info The reward is calculated upon delivery of 20 MD per month (1MD=8h)

Project duration 11-35 months with the possibility of extension
Period of cooperation 01.02.2026 - 31.12.2026
Start date 02.02.2026 or by agreement
Technology
  • AWS Amazon Web Services
  • PostgreSQL
  • Apache Kafka
  • Hibernate
  • Java EE
  • Jenkins
  • WS Webservice REST
  • Docker
  • oAuth2
  • ReactJS
  • TypeScript
  • Keycloak
  • Spring Boot
  • TeamCity
Languages
  • English flag English - conversational, B1
  • Slovak or Czech flag Slovak or Czech - active, B2/C1/C2

Project description

  • cooperation in full-stack (primarily front-end) development of innovative core banking applications in ReactJS and JAVA (Spring Boot 3) for the banking sector
  • participation in the design, development, testing, deployment, maintenance and improvement of systems
  • close cooperation with ICT and business analysts
  • participation in CI/CD processes including code reviews
  • prospect of long-term cooperation in an agile (SCRUM / SAFe) team
  • after initial mainly ON-SITE training, cooperation will be possible in a combined ON-SITE (Bratislava) / REMOTE mode - depending on the preferences of the freelancer and the needs of the project

Project requirements

  • min. 3 years of active experience in programming front-end parts of applications (ideally in ReactJS)
  • min. 3 years of active experience in programming back-end parts of applications in JAVA
  • excellent knowledge of object-oriented programming principles (OOP)
  • advanced experience with:
    • TypeScript and/or JavaScript
    • Java 2 Platform, Enterprise Edition (ideally J2EE 11+)
  • experience with:
    • React Hooks
    • React component libraries (MaterialUI)
    • SQL databases (PostgreSQL)
    • Spring framework (Spring Boot) and Hibernate
    • automated build tools (Maven, Jenkins, TeamCity, ...)
    • repository systems (GitHub, Bitbucket...)
    • HTTP client Axios
    • testing tools and frameworks (Jest, RTL, Karma, Cypress.io, Playwright, ...)
    • microservices (Docker, Kubernetes)
  • knowledge of English language at a conversational level (in speech and writing)
     
  • experience with is a great advantage:
    • Enterprise messaging systems (KafkaMQ, JMS, RabbitMQ, IBM MQ...)
    • IdP (KeyCloak)
       
  • experience with is an advantage:
    • cloud services (AWS, Azure, GCP, ...)
    • one of the agile software development methods (SCRUM, LEAN and/or KANBAN)
    • using project-tracking tools (JIRA, Confluence)
    • Quarkus framework
    • application security (AuthN, AuthZ, OAuth2 flows...)
    • working in a banking environment
    • performing effective code reviews and adhering to coding standards
       
  • independent, responsible and proactive approach
  • attention to detail
Are you interested in this project?
Recommend an IT specialist Do you know anyone who could use this project? Recommend him and get a reward 480 €!
Hire an IT specialist Do you need a similar IT freelancer for your project? Hire a specialist
New to the world of IT freelancing ?

Freedom, flexibility, greater control over finances and career. Freelancing has evolved and offers much more today. See what's in store for you and how it will change your life.

Are you interested in this project?
Recommend an IT specialist Do you know anyone who could use this project? Recommend him and get a reward 480 €!
Hire an IT specialist Do you need a similar IT freelancer for your project? Hire a specialist
31 146

Titans that have
joined us

728

Clients that have
joined us

661 596

Succcessfully supplied
man-days